Energy sources can be placed in two categories: renewable and nonrenewable. How do you think these two energy sources differ from each other?

Respuesta :

xxtheamazingkyliexx xxtheamazingkyliexx
  • 12-01-2021

Answer:

Renewable energy sources can come again, but nonrenewable is gone forever. For example, coal and gasoline are both nonrenewable.
